I have officially entered the "Inquiry" Process in the United Methodist Church.  I have a mentor, who is one that will truly keep me accountable.  She is a Deacon in El Paso and has worked with my husband quite a bit.  We had our first meeting yesterday.  She is fantastic :)

This process the United Methodist Church has developed helps those who have a call to ministry to discern what they are hearing and feeling.  Sometimes people go through this process and decide to not move forward.  That very well may be what happens with me.  I have not a clue what is to come, I just know that God is leading me to discover what He is truly laying on my heart.
